轮椅稳定性:身体姿势的影响。

Wheelchair stability: effect of body position.

作者信息

Kirby R L, Sampson M T, Thoren F A, MacLeod D A

机构信息

Department of Medicine, Dalhousie University, Nova Scotia, Canada.

出版信息

J Rehabil Res Dev. 1995 Nov;32(4):367-72.

PMID:8770801
Abstract

When a wheelchair user reaches and leans, the static stability decreases in the direction of the lean and increases in the opposite direction. The purpose of this study was to determine the extent of this effect. We studied 21 nondisabled subjects in a representative wheelchair, measuring the static forward, rear, and lateral stability on a tilting platform. Reaching and leaning away from the tip added stability, with mean increases ranging from 9.1% to 124.3% of the neutral-position values, whereas reaching and leaning toward the tip reduced stability, with mean decreases ranging from 25.2% to 52.3% (p < 0.0001). The stability range ("away" minus "toward") varied from 52.4% to 149.5%. Reaching forward had a greater effect on stability than did reaching back or to the side. Wheelchair users with the ability to control their body positions can profoundly affect the stability of their wheelchairs, a factor that should be considered in wheelchair selection and training.

当轮椅使用者伸手并倾斜时,静态稳定性会在倾斜方向上降低,而在相反方向上增加。本研究的目的是确定这种影响的程度。我们让21名非残疾受试者使用代表性轮椅,在倾斜平台上测量静态向前、向后和侧向稳定性。远离轮椅前端伸手并倾斜会增加稳定性,平均增加幅度为中立位置值的9.1%至124.3%,而朝着轮椅前端伸手并倾斜则会降低稳定性,平均降低幅度为25.2%至52.3%(p < 0.0001)。稳定性范围(“远离”减去“朝着”)从52.4%到149.5%不等。向前伸手对稳定性的影响比对向后或向侧面伸手的影响更大。能够控制身体姿势的轮椅使用者会深刻影响其轮椅的稳定性,这一因素在轮椅选择和训练中应予以考虑。
